
Until Microsoft unveils
its (rumored) contribution to mobile gaming, we'll have to settle for its (much bigger) daddy.
Dave over at portablesystems.net has posted a bunch of photos from his portable Xbox hack which features a decent sized LCD, battery power and a surprisingly authentic green paint job. You've got to marvel at the effort that must have gone into this project, although you'll excuse us for being equally excited at the prospect of seeing the Xman's offspring.
